Hot on the heels of the Metroid Prime 3: Corruption reviews I stumbled upon something interesting at Shacknews and found the same info at IGN. Apparently a console can be scanned and the following message is displayed: ""Experiment status report update: Metroid project 'Dread' is nearing the final stages of completion." http://www.shacknews.com/onearticle.x/48650 http://ds.ign.com/articles/815/815899p1.html Metroid Dread was a rumored 2D game for the DS from back in 2005.
